We present constraints on the mass-radius relation for the neutron star in the X-ray burst source 18 by using model spectra for X-ray bursts based on the theory developed by Titarchuk 1994. Under the assumption of isotropic burst emission the derived results exclude the stiffer equations of state of neutron star matter. The theory can be used to derive distances to X-ray burst sources from which only burst luminosities below the Eddington limit are observed. We apply it to 17 and find a distance of 7.4^+0.8^_-1.1_ kpc, assuming similar neutron star mass and radius for 17 and 18 and a neutron star atmosphere with cosmic element abundance for 17.
